We guarantee the view! Savor your coffee on the deck with the sunrise and have happy hour looking over the ocean when the sun sets. This is a delightfully decorated 4 bedroom, 3.5 bath home with everything you have at home, plus a view. The kitchen is well-equipped with anything a prepare might need. If cooking is not your thing there are great eateries in Ocean Isle, Sunset, and Calabash. Each bedroom has a TV/DVD. . You will feel like you are home away from home with all of the amenities including Wi-Fi. The downstairs deck in ideal for watching the kids on the beach or for a gathering spot. The upstairs deck is off of the master bedroom and is a great place to sun or to read a book.

The downstairs bedroom has a queen bed and a twin bed. It has a connecting bathroom with a shower. Three of the bedrooms are located upstairs. The back and middle bedrooms share a Jack and Jill bath with a double vanity area and separate tub and shower. The master bedroom has it's own bath with a shower and both upstairs baths have skylights. The back bedroom has a queen size bed and a twin bed with a trundle. The middle room is ideal for the kids. There are bunk beds along with a full size bed. The master bedroom has a king size bed and a sitting area.

The home is part of a duplex at the calming end of the beach near the inlet.(Both sides of the duplex may be available upon request.) For those looking to stay busy, some of the best golf courses are located within 10 min. of the home. Myrtle Beach, SC, is just 25 miles away with anything you would like to do. Spend a day shopping at the outlets or take in a show at the Palace Theater. If you are in the mood for a peaceful, modest town ambiance, Southport, NC is a short drive from Ocean Isle. The streets are lined with antique stores and great water front dining. You can also take the Fort Fisher Ferry from Southport to Fort Fisher/Wilmington to visit the Aquarium, Battleship North Carolina or have lunch on the waterfront. If your plan is to do as little as possible, Ocean Isle Beach fits the bill too. The beach is at your door step. There are phenomenal surf and deep sea fishing opportunities in the area. Bicycle units are available on the island as well as kayaks. This is a place where everybody can find what they want to do or not do, as the case may be. How to find the best Wilmington, NC vacation property experience:

Find your perfect rental:

  • In the Wilmington, NC area, The sooner your group can reserve a vacation home, the easier your search will be. The best vacation rentals are reserved very early. Reserving your rental property six to twelve months before your vacation dates is recommended. Christmas, Thanksgiving and New Years Eve are excellent times to plan and reserve your rental property.
  • Summer is the most expensive season in coastal NC. Booking your Wilmington, NC vacation home in Spring or Fall is an excellent way to save money on your vacation rental. Rates are lower, and you'll find a better selection of acceptable homes. Many vacationers use this method to find larger homes within budget, or to book a beach front vacation r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the high season.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ook the holidays for a Wilmington, NC v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ation on the coast? Thanksgiving and Christmas are great times to gather with family and friends at the beach.
  • Some owners offer discounts for active duty military and veterans. It's always a good idea to check with your property manager to see if special discounts are available for your group before you book.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ners often offer renters an option to add vacation insurance protection. Trip insurance, which cost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any missed time as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ather, as well as ev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el overnight or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ance can be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ask the property owner for more information.
  • Many rental management companies supply Wilmington, NC area travel guides which include coupons, either offered independently by local companies, or through a relationship with the management company and the business itself. You can also find Wilmington, NC visitors guide magazine and coupon books at local grocery stores, shopping centers, and visitor centers.

Planning and choosing your prefect Wilmington, NC rental:

  • Choose a designated group leader, select your vacation week, and choose a budget.
  • Note the number beds and the configuration you need. Bright Beautiful Ocean Front Home has 4 bedrooms and 4 bathrooms.
  • Precise descriptions of bedrooms and bed counts is regularly accessible on booking websites. If you don't see them listed, reach out to the property owner before booking the property. Note that most properties list the max. guest capacity, which usually includes sofa beds in living rooms.
  • Traveling with pets? Although a number of vacation homes allow pets or animals, guidelines and costs vary per property. Allowable pet type, breed, and size are often limited. Remember to ask your host before booking, and study your rental agreement! Additional fees or charges could be applied to your contract.
  • Are you looking for special amenities? Most rental search websites include search filters with amenity lists. Amenity filters help you quickly remove less-optimal properties.
  • Proper accessibility can make or ruin a vacation for the less-mobile. Confirm all necessary amenities are available and included before reserving a rental

Have a great stay:

  • Put the owner's contact information in your smartphone.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a garage door opener, stereo or WIFI setup.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ief telephone call can prevent quite a few concerns.
  • Lock your vacation home while you are out. Protect your property!
  • During arrival, document any issues with the rental property and immediately alert the host. Record all correspondence in case a dispute arises.
  • Respecting qu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able. You will increase your chance to make some new local friends, and resident neighbors can be an incredible source for finding the best local spots.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Locals can often help. Who better to ask where to book the best tours, have a great night out, or the best spots for bird watching?
  • Re-check every room of the rental property to confirm that you've packed all personal items on check-out day. Re-check bathrooms, dressers, and closets for hidden items. Clean out the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Record a video to document the condition of the property.
  • After your trip, leave feedback! Property managers rely on excellent reviews to inspire future reservations. They'll be grateful for your review.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other vacationers will be thankful you shared your review find their best rental home. Be fair with your review.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the owner could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ded quickly to solve it.

Victory Beach Vacations

Visitors who are on the hunt for the postcard-perfect vacation rental in the heart of the Carolina Beach or Kure Beach area will find an enticing selection and plenty of friendly customer service when they rent through Victory Beach Vacations. Based in Carolina Beach in the coastal Cape Fear region, Victory Beach Vacations has more than 100 vacation rentals in all shapes and sizes to ensure that every vacationing family can find their dream home away from home on the beach.   When you book your Cape Fear getaway with Victory Beach Vacations, the fun doesn’t end when you leave the beach, it continues with an array of privately-owned properties outfitted with all of the amenities needed for a fabulous beach vacation.   Jenna Lanier, General Manager, explains that her family first opened the rental and property management business in 2002. At the forefront of Victory Beach operations is Lanier’s mother, Caroline Meeks. Meeks is both the Broker in Charge and co-owner with husband, Buck Meeks, who manages the Field Services team with Lanier’s husband, Scott.   For nearly 20 years, the Victory Beach team has worked tirelessly to establish a network of top-of-the-line rental properties for Cape Fear visitors to enjoy. “As far as our properties go,” explains Lanier, “they are all updated, well-furnished and appointed. “We have always performed post-cleaning inspections and since the pandemic, have put freshly laundered duvets over all of the comforters between rentals.”   Lanier emphasizes how important the guests experience is “we strive to give our guests a relaxing, stress free, memorable vacation.” This emphasis on customer service has led to Victory Beach Vacations having a 4.8 Google rating with over 300 reviews by happy owners and guests.In addition to Victory Beach’s superior sanitation practices, the company offers properties for every type of visitor. Choose from luxury oceanfront houses and condos to more reasonbly priced 2nd row properties with oceanviews.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al. We have several properties on the harbor so guests can bring their boat, kayak, [or jet ski] and travel between islands,” says Lanier.   A stay with Victory Beach Vacations is an annual pilgrimage for most. “A large percentage of guests are previous guests. Some even reserve the same property for the next year as they’re checking out,” Lanier says. “It’s almost like it’s their personal vacation home.”   Even before guests arrive at their vacation destination, the Victory Beach Vacations’ website greets them with a live beach cam and exquisite aerial footage of both Carolina and Kure Beaches.
